What is an xray assistant?

Xray Assistants, also known as Radiology Assistants or Radiologic Technologist Assistants, are healthcare professionals who support radiologic technologists and radiologists in performing diagnostic imaging procedures. Their duties include preparing patients for X-ray exams, maintaining and operating imaging equipment, assisting with patient positioning, and ensuring safety protocols are followed. They also help with administrative tasks such as managing patient records and scheduling appointments. Xray Assistants play a crucial role in ensuring that imaging procedures run smoothly and efficiently while prioritizing patient care and safety.

What does an xray assistant do?

As an Xray Assistant, your daily responsibilities often include preparing patients for imaging procedures, ensuring the exam rooms and equipment are clean and ready, and assisting radiologic technologists with patient positioning and administrative tasks. You may also help with maintaining patient records and managing the flow of patients to ensure efficient department operations. This support is crucial for smooth workflow and allows technologists to focus on producing high-quality diagnostic images. Effective communication and teamwork with both technologists and patients are key aspects of the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an xray assistant?

To thrive as an X-ray Assistant, you need a basic understanding of radiologic procedures, anatomy, and patient care, often supported by a certificate or on-the-job training in medical imaging. Familiarity with radiology equipment, PACS (Picture Archiving and Communication System), and adherence to radiation safety protocols are essential. Strong attention to detail, communication skills, and the ability to reassure and position patients effectively are vital soft skills. These competencies ensure accurate imaging, patient comfort, and safe, efficient workflow in medical diagnostic settings.

What is the difference between Xray Assistant vs Xray Technician?

AspectXray AssistantXray Technician
CertificationsOften requires basic radiology assisting certification or on-the-job trainingRequires formal certification or licensing, such as ARRT certification
Work EnvironmentAssists in hospitals, clinics, and outpatient facilities under supervisionPerforms diagnostic imaging independently in medical settings
Job ResponsibilitiesPrepares patients, positions them, and assists radiologistsOperates X-ray equipment, captures images, and ensures image quality

In summary, Xray Assistants typically support radiology staff with patient prep and equipment handling, often with less formal certification. Xray Technicians perform the actual imaging procedures, requiring certification and more technical expertise. Both roles are essential in medical imaging but differ in responsibilities and qualifications.

X-Ray Technologist (Radiologic Technologist)

Job Summary:
The X-Ray Technologist performs diagnostic radiographic examinations to assist physicians in the diagnosis and treatment of medical conditions. The technologist prepares patients for imaging procedures, operates radiographic equipment, produces high-quality diagnostic images, ensures radiation safety, and collaborates with the healthcare team to provide safe, efficient, and compassionate patient care.

Requirements:

  • Graduate of an accredited Radiologic Technology program.

  • Current ARRT (R) certification required.

  • Current state Radiologic Technologist license if required by the state of practice.

  • Current BLS certification preferred or required per facility policy.

  • Recent diagnostic radiology or acute care imaging experience preferred.

Responsibilities:

  • Perform routine and specialized diagnostic X-ray examinations according to physician orders and departmental protocols.

  • Prepare, position, and educate patients for imaging procedures while ensuring comfort and safety.

  • Operate radiographic equipment to obtain high-quality diagnostic images.

  • Follow radiation safety principles and maintain compliance with ALARA standards.

  • Verify patient identity, procedure accuracy, and image quality before submission.

  • Maintain accurate documentation and electronic medical records.

  • Assist with equipment quality control and report equipment issues as needed.

  • Collaborate with radiologists, physicians, and the interdisciplinary healthcare team.

  • Follow infection prevention, patient safety, HIPAA, and regulatory standards.
